WebThe Dungeness crab may reach 10 inches across the back, though 6 to 7 inches is more common. Geographic range. This hard-shelled crustacean is fished from the Aleutian Islands to Mexico. In Puget Sound this crab is most abundant north of Seattle, in Hood Canal, and near the Pacific Coast. The Dungeness crab is frequently found in eelgrass …
